Toxoplasma gondii has recently been recognized to be widely prevalent in the marine environment. It has previously been determined that Eastern oysters (Crassostrea virginica) can remove sporulated T. gondii oocysts from seawater and that oocysts retain their infectivity for mice. Toxoplasmosis is a major zoonotic disease of warm-blooded animals caused by Toxoplasma gondii. Cats are the only definitive host and they excrete environmentally resistant T. gondii oocysts in their faeces. Journal: :Journal of clinical microbiology 1986
M B Heyman L K Shigekuni A J Ammann

A method was developed to obtain purified cryptosporidium oocysts from fecal samples. Oocysts were initially collected by centrifugation through a sucrose density gradient and further purified by passage through glass bead columns. The purified oocysts were antigenically active and sufficiently pure for immunological studies.
